Kita (5378) reviewed Mordor Morning Stout from Ringu Brewing 4 months 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 8 | Flavor - 7.5 | Texture - 9 | Overall - 8
On tap @ Ghetto Something. Aroma of roasted malt, bitter chocolate and maple syrup with earthy note. Pours pitch black color with thick creamy light brown head. Tastes of rich roasted malt, chocolate, liquor and maple syrup, mouthfeel is warm alcoholic, while finish is mild bitter. Full body, syrupy texture and soft carbonation in palate. Lord of the Ringus…

oh6gdx (51641) reviewed Mordor Morning Stout from Ringu Brewing 1 year 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 7.5 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 8
Thanks omhper! Pitch black colour, small brown head. Aroma is roasted cold coffee with some toffee, maple syrupy and mild earth. Flavour is coffee, liquorice, chocolate syrupy tones with mild alcohol and some espresso burnt tones. Somewhat alcoholic kick too in the flavour. Still a nice one.
Gyllenbock (17550) reviewed Mordor Morning Stout from Ringu Brewing 1 year 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 5.5 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 5.5
Can from Systembolaget beställningssortiment. Black with a small tan head. Sweet with dark malt, maple syrup, soy sauce and butterscotch. Warming alcohol in the finish. Drinkable but not the best one from Ringu Brewing.
omhper (45152) reviewed Mordor Morning Stout from Ringu Brewing 1 year ago
Appearance - 3 | Aroma - 3 | Flavor - 4 | Texture - 3 | Overall - 3.5
Canned, from Systembolaget. Black, faint fizzy head. Butterscotch dominates the nose. Sweet with medium to full body and fizzy, somewhat sticky mouthfeel. Lots of butterscotch, some syrup and soy sauce. Peppery warming finish with some bitterness. Is this intended? If so, why?
